Track 01
Innovations in Airport Design

This track focuses on the latest advancements in airport design, emphasizing sustainable practices and technological integration. Participants will explore case studies and emerging trends that enhance passenger experience and operational efficiency.

Track 02
Launch Pad Engineering and Safety

This session examines the critical aspects of launch pad engineering, including structural integrity and safety protocols. Discussions will center on innovative designs and technologies that ensure safe and efficient launch operations.

Track 03
Aerospace Ground Facilities Maintenance

This track addresses the challenges and best practices in the maintenance of aerospace ground facilities. Participants will share insights on optimizing maintenance schedules and improving facility reliability.

Track 04
Aerospace Logistics and Supply Chain Management

This session delves into the complexities of aerospace logistics, focusing on supply chain optimization for space launch systems. Experts will discuss strategies for enhancing efficiency and reducing costs in aerospace operations.

Track 05
Structural Systems in Aerospace Infrastructure

This track explores the design and analysis of structural systems within aerospace infrastructure. Participants will engage in discussions on innovative materials and engineering techniques that enhance structural performance.

Track 06
Launch Vehicle Integration Techniques

This session focuses on the integration processes of launch vehicles, highlighting the engineering challenges and solutions. Attendees will learn about best practices and emerging technologies that streamline integration workflows.

Track 07
Spaceport Operations and Management

This track examines the operational aspects of spaceports, including management strategies and operational efficiency. Participants will discuss the role of technology in enhancing spaceport functionality and safety.

Track 08
Runway and Terminal Systems Engineering

This session addresses the engineering challenges associated with runway and terminal systems. Experts will present innovative designs and technologies that improve safety and operational capacity.

Track 09
Aerospace Infrastructure Planning and Development

This track focuses on the strategic planning and development of aerospace infrastructure. Participants will explore frameworks for effective infrastructure planning that align with future aviation and space needs.

Track 10
Aerospace Operations Support Systems

This session investigates the critical support systems that underpin aerospace operations. Discussions will include advancements in technology that enhance operational support and decision-making processes.

Track 11
Advanced Aviation-Space Infrastructure

This track explores the intersection of aviation and space infrastructure, focusing on advanced systems that support both domains. Participants will discuss innovative solutions that facilitate seamless integration between aviation and space operations.
